Five ways we can harness the original renewable energy source – human power

Daniel Shin, Nottingham Trent University Human power used to be all the rage. 150 years ago, products that relied on human energy such as the bicycle, pedal-powered lathe or sewing machine could be found in most households. But as electro-mechanical motors developed, reliance on human-powered products gradually diminished. Today, human power is not appropriately recognised […]
